Commercial Satellite Imaging Market to Surpass Revenues of Over USD 7 Billion by 2027 - Exclusive Report by Mordor IntelligenceMordor IntelligenceCommercial satellite imagery's military and defense applications have been the major end-user verticals. Most countries' defense and military budgets are predicted to increase to create security initiatives, which will boost the market's growth. According to SIPRI, total global military spending increased by 0.7 percent in real terms in 2021, reaching USD 2.1 trillion. The US, China, India, the UK, and Russia were the top five spenders in 2021, accounting for 62 percent of total spending.

Commercial Satellite Imaging Market Overview

The commercial satellite imaging market was valued at USD 4.15 billion in 2022, and it is expected to reach USD 7.08 billion by 2027, witnessing a CAGR of 11.25% during the forecast period (2022-2027). The significance of satellite imaging has prompted governmental organizations to support its growth. Various governments have been supporting the firms in the market studied by investing in satellite imaging technologies. The Australian government invested in satellite technologies, and it spent USD 260 million on the development of satellite technology and the creation of jobs in Australia.

BlackSky, a geospatial intelligence company, announced that it secured USD 50 million loans from the Intelsat satellite powerhouse, primarily to boost its nascent earth observation constellation. The company also announced its plans to use this capital to build on its existing assets and alliances. The company primarily aims to incorporate access to Intelsat’s communications infrastructure to deliver its imaging and intelligence services across the world.

Commercial Satellite Imaging Market - Geographical Overview

North America is expected to dominate the market studied during the forecast period due to the highest number of research and investments in the market studied, the presence of sophisticated infrastructure to undertake space programs, and the earliest and highest adoption of commercial satellite imaging across various industries in the region.

The market studied is anticipated to widen further in the region as a result of the federal government's significant support for grants to academic institutions and industries to create highly advanced satellite imaging systems. The United States controls 2,944 of the 4,852 active artificial satellites circling the Earth as of January 1, 2022, according to the Union of Concerned Scientists, with China accounting for only 499.

SpaceX launched a radar-imaging satellite for Spain's Hisdesat Servicios Estrategicos SA, as well as a broadband demonstration satellite. In addition, SpaceX is responsible for almost a quarter of all launches worldwide. In 2020, SpaceX was predicted to launch 21.8 percent of all rockets.

Recent Developments in the Commercial Satellite Imaging Market

  • May 2022 - The National Reconnaissance Office has given 10-year contracts to BlackSky, Maxar Technologies, and Planet Labs to provide satellite imagery to US intelligence, defense, and civil organizations. These awards were the NRO's "largest-ever commercial imagery contracting initiative," according to the agency. These contracts represent a historic expansion of the NRO's commercial imagery acquisition to satisfy growing client demand with increased capability.
  • May 2022- Microsoft said that it is collaborating with partners to discover commercial space applications. NASA is investigating a Microsoft program called Custom Vision to see whether it may help simplify the work of inspecting astronaut gloves for signs of damage during spacewalks, which is one of the numerous applications being examined for Hewlett Packard Enterprise's Spaceborne Computer 2.
